CAROLINE AND ART STOECKER SCHOLARSHIP
NAME:This scholarship shall be known as the Caroline and Art Stoecker Scholarship. Caroline (Billings) Stoecker was an early graduate of Jetmore (Niederacher) High School. She attended Fort Hays State College and taught in elementary schools for many years in Hodgeman County. Caroline and Art Stoecker were long term supporters of higher education.
QUALIFICATIONS:This scholarship will be awarded to a graduating senior or recent graduate of Hodgeman County High School who is enrolled in an approved course of study (at least 12 semester credit hours), in an accredited college or university. The scholarship will be awarded on the basis of scholarship and financial need. First preference will be given to those who plan to major in education or agriculture. This scholarship is awarded for a maximum or one academic year but must be renewed at the beginning of each term. The recipient must maintain a 2.5 grade point average (on a 4 point system).
AMOUNT:The amount of the award will be $800.00. One half of the award will be available to the recipient after the add and drop period of each semester.
CHOICE OF
RECIPIENT:The choice of the recipient shall be made by a committee composed of the following people: a) high school principal b) high school counselor, c) a member of the Hodgeman County High School faculty, and d) a member of the community. The high school principal shall serve as chairman of the committee.
